Forbidden love in 'The Princess of His Heart' fics thrives on conflict. My favorite trope is the princess falling for someone who’s supposed to be her enemy—maybe a rival kingdom’s spy or a disgraced noble. The societal pressure here isn’t just rules; it’s loyalty, war, even legacy. A fic I read had the princess torn between her love and her duty to avenge her family. The CP’s chemistry was electric because every touch was a betrayal. The angst writes itself.

The forbidden love trope in 'The Princess of His Heart' fics hits different because it’s not just about romance—it’s about power dynamics. The princess is usually trapped in a gilded cage, expected to marry for alliances, not affection. The CP’s love is a rebellion, and that’s what makes it addictive. I’ve read fics where the love interest is a rebel leader, turning their romance into a political act. The societal pressure isn’t just disapproval; it’s life or death. One standout fic had the princess publicly denounce her lover to save him, only for him to understand and love her more for it. The emotional depth comes from sacrifice, not just longing. Some stories explore the aftermath—what happens when they do get together? The court’s whispers, the nobles’ sabotage, the constant threat of assassination. It’s messy, and that’s the point. The best fics make you root for them even when the world says they shouldn’t exist.
